Key Replacement
A lot of cars today have a key fob that lets you unlock your car doors and start the engine with the press of the button. The keys have a microchip inside that is programmed for your specific car's computer system so that it can detect and communicate with the vehicle. This enables the car to determine that it is the correct key and the driver has authority to use it. You may have to pay lots of money to the dealer to replace your lost key. But, there is an alternative: an aftermarket key from a third party company. These keys are less expensive than the keys from the dealer and can be purchased online.
If you are looking to replace your key, you'll require your vehicle identification number (VIN). The VIN is located on the driver's side door post or on a plate made of metal in the driver-side dashboard. You must also have your registration and insurance details.
If you lose your key It is recommended to contact an locksmith as soon as you can. They can assist you in replacing the keys and then program the keys to your vehicle. The majority of auto locksmiths are able to do this at a lower cost than dealerships. Dealers can charge as much as $200 for a key, including towing fees.
Transponder Keys
The majority of car keys are equipped with a transponder, which means they communicate with the vehicle via radio frequency. This is a much safer and more secure choice than keys without transponders, which don't have this feature, and are much more difficult to duplicate.
A transponder, or miniature electronic key, is a digital chip (actually a set of windings akin to those in an electric motor). The engine control unit transmits an alert to your chip when you insert the original transponder into ignition. This chip sends a code to the immobilizer system in the car, which disables it.
Transponder chips are standard on many newer vehicles. They are designed to stop car theft, particularly from old-fashioned thieves that often use brutal force and a 'hot wire' approach. It is important to remember that nothing is foolproof, and criminals are constantly devising ways to take advantage of this technology.
The cost to replace transponder keys varies depending on the year, model, and manufacturer of your vehicle. It can be a bit more expensive than a basic metal key but it's worth it for the added security that this technology can provide. Generally, you can get transponder keys made at most locksmiths and a few local stores like AutoZone or Walmart.
Keyless Entry Remotes
If the remote key fob has stopped working after being dropped on the floor, or it has a battery that is dead and is not able to be replaced, the internal chip might have been damaged by water. A defective receiver module or signal interference, could also cause the issue. In some instances, it could assist in resetting the onboard computers by disconnecting the battery that is 12 volts for a short period of time. The negative cable should be removed first, then the positive one. It is also an ideal idea to remove any electrical equipment that is not in use.
The most common cause of a key fob that won't lock or unlock the doors is a dead battery. This can be fixed by using a small screwdriver to remove the cover of the fob within the region of the arrows. Then, take off the old battery and replace it with a new one, ensuring that the + symbol is facing downwards.
